Yan SU粟燕
Associate Professor

Academic Qualification

  • Ph.D. in Mechanical Engineering, University of Minnesota, USA (2006)
  • MS in Mechanical Engineering, Hong Kong University of Science & Technology, Hong Kong (2003)
  • BS in Thermal Engineering, Tsinghua University, China (2000)

Research

Research Interests

  • Renewable Energy and Solar Energy Systems
  • Thermal Dispersion in Porous Medium
  • Three Dimensional Numerical Simulations of Oscillating Flows and Heat Transfer
  • Microencapsulated Slurries of PCM
  • Indoor Air Quality
